SUMMARY OF POSITION:

Diagnose and treat acute, episodic, or chronic illness, independently or as part of a healthcare team. May focus on health promotion and disease prevention. May order, perform, or interpret diagnostic tests such as lab work and x-rays. May prescribe. Works in an inpatient critical care area.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ATION(S):

  • Either Master's Degree in a Critical Care or Acute Care Nurse Practitioner Program with a minimum of one (1) year CRNP experience (which could include clinical rotations or relevant clinical experience in applicable specialty) required and three (3) years critical care experience as a staff nurse required; or Master's Degree in a General Nurse Practitioner Program with a minimum of one (1) year CRNP experience (which could include clinical rotations or relevant clinical experience in applicable specialty) and five (5) years critical care experience as a staff nurse required.
  • National certification as an Advanced Practice Nurse required.
  • Current license to practice as a CRNP by Pennsylvania Board of Nurse Examiners required.
  •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) and Basic Cardiopulmonary Life Support (BCLS) certifications required.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ATION(S):

  • Acute Care certification
